Hey lads, PAOK fan here, it was a honour playing with a club like yours. Chelsea is one of the most dominant clubs to ever play in Toumba Stadium and we faced lots of decent ones the last 5 years( Schalke, Ajax, Dortmund , Benfica, Tottenham etc.). I have never seen a club destroying us like you did today.  just another level of football.  You gotta respect the way Sarri's clubs control the game. Tactical masterpiece. I guess you are dissapointed by the incompetence of PAOK against such a strong rival, but you also have to take into account that our club plays with its 3 arch rivals in the next 10 days for Greek league and domestic cup, so our coach decided to play very conservative. People here are obsessed with those matches and losing them will be a disaster probably. Losing with dignity from Chelsea is not a big deal though..   Even full strength the difference of the clubs would be chaotic though, like 2-3 goals difference at least. Wish you luck for PL this year, it is a disgrace such a team not to participate in CL.  See ya in London.
